Control de Versiones de Paquetes Anidados
|
|
Cuando guarda un Paquete en el sistema de control de versiones, sólo información en fragmentos es exportada para cualquier Paquete anidado. Esto protege información de un Paquete anidado de ser sobrescrita de manera inadvertida por un Paquete de nivel superior.
Operaciones en Paquetes Anidados
Operación
|
Detalle
|
Ver También
|
Desproteger
|
Cuando desprotege un Paquete, no modifica o elimina Paquetes anidados; sólo se modifica el Paquete de nivel superior.
Como una consecuencia de este comportamiento, si desprotege u obtiene un Paquete controlado por versiones con Paquetes anidados que no están ya en su modelo, usted ve fragmentos en el modelo para los Paquetes anidados únicamente.
|
|
Obtener Todos los Últimos
|
Si selecciona la opción
Obtener Todos los Últimos del menú de control de versiones, cuales quiera nuevos fragmentos son poblados desde el sistema de controlar de versiones.
|
Obtener Todos los Últimos
|
Importar Modelos
|
Puede poblar un modelo grande y complejo, al 'obtener' sólo los Paquetes raíz, luego utilizando Obtener Todos los Últimos para iterar recursivamente a través de los Paquetes adjuntos y anidados.
Esto es un medio poderoso y eficiente de administrar su proyecto y simplifica manejar modelos muy grandes, incluso en un entorno distribuido.
La opción Importar una Rama Modelo combina los pasos descritos arriba en una única operación.
|
Obtener Paquete
Importar Rama de Modelo Controlada
|
Notas
•
|
Es recomendado que, al comenzar un modelo de control de versiones, que no mezcle versiones de Enterprise Architect posteriores que la versión 4.5 con versiones anteriores; si esto es necesario es mejor ir a la ventana de Configuraciones de Control de Versiones y deseleccionar la casilla Guardar paquetes de control de versiones anidados en fragmentos únicamente, configurar Enterprise Architect al comportamiento de la pre-versión 4.5 (para el modelo actual únicamente)
|
|